Job Description
Reporting to the International Senior Tax Manager, this position will support all aspects of US outbound international and transfer pricing matters of a US-based technology multinational Corporation.
Qualifications
  • Assist with various US International tax calculations and analyses including E&P, FTC positions, Subpart-F, GILTI, FDII, and BEAT for planning, quarterly & year end provision and compliance purposes
  • Managing international components of the co-sourced US tax compliance process, including all related computations, forms, disclosures & schedules.
  • Assist with modelling and analyzing scenarios to assess and advise on potential tax implications from operational changes, restructuring initiatives, and tax law changes.
  • Project management on critical tax restructuring projects such as IP onshoring and buy-sell conversion.
  • Review contracts and collaborate with legal and the business to ensure contracts contain key terms consistent with global tax structure
  • Assist in international tax planning, including subpart F minimization, repatriation, intercompany funding, foreign tax credit and foreign source income planning, international M&A, Federal legislative planning, and non-US ETR planning. Identifying and developing opportunities for ETR, cash, go-to-market and supply-chain efficiencies
  • Partnering with regional finance and tax personnel to review and provide feedback as needed on foreign reporting packages and tax provisions at quarter-end and year-end, as well as provision-to-return true-up analysis.
  • Manage post-acquisition restructuring of target's IP and legal entity footprint
  • Monitoring and assessing proposed tax legislation in the U.S. and significant foreign jurisdictions and assess impact to Company and for potential opportunities, exposures, and mitigating strategies.
  • Review Permanent Establishment risk identifiers and metrics and implementation of strategies to mitigate PE risk.
  • Supporting transfer pricing planning, maintenance, calculations, documentation and potential for automation for intercompany transactions such as royalty, cost sharing, management fee, and profitability of foreign cost+ and limited risk distributor subsidiaries. This is a co-sourced relationship with outside service providers.
  • Supporting & defending US international audit issues and foreign tax audits.
  • Research and advise business divisions and local finance team on global withholding tax requirements.
  • Supporting tax technology, automation, and process improvement initiatives as it relates to international tax matters and computations.

Additional Information
  • BA/BS in accounting; Masters in Taxation and/or CPA and/or JD preferred
  • Minimum 6+ years overall experience with US multinational tax operations
  • Preference for combination of public company industry and Big 4 background
  • Strong technical experience in US international tax. US GAAP income tax accounting experience with international tax matters preferred.
  • Results-driven with a high level of initiative, urgency, accountability and integrity
  • Strong excel skills or an enthusiasm to strengthen such skills for efficiencies
  • Strong project management and organizational skills to managing projects involving external advisors, auditors, regional finance, and business teams. Partnering and developing relationships with various groups to ensure cross-functional alignment throughout the organization.
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ills and capable of explaining work products and calculations to non-tax cross functional teams and business leaders.
  • Proven track record to meet various deadlines associated with day-to-day responsibilities alongside special project-work
